Byron Nelson Quotes

2 Sourced Quotes

    • Source
    • Report...
Every great player has learned the two Cs: how to concentrate and how to maintain composure.

Byron Nelson
    • Source
    • Report...
The first step in building a solid, dependable attitude is to be realistic, not only about your inherent capabilities, but also about how well you are playing to those capabilities on any given day.

Byron Nelson

Byron Nelson
Creative Commons

Born: February 4, 1912
Died: September 26, 2006 (aged 94)
Bio: John Byron Nelson, Jr. was an American professional golfer between 1935 and 1946, one of the greats not only in his day but over the history of the sport.
Known for:
  1. How I Played the Game: An Autobiography (1993)
  2. Byron Nelson's Winning Golf (1946)
  3. Shape Your Swing the Modern Way (1975)
